Early Antique Khamseh Tribal Carpet. Arab-jabbareh Tribe. Shekarlu Border. 305cm X 183cm.

19th century
Description

South west persia. By the arab-jabbareh tribe of the khamseh confederation.

Third quarter 19th century,circa 1870.

Quite an early carpet size weaving with an interesting main border pattern of this tribes interpretation of a shekarlu pattern the type seen in qashqai weavings.

Indigo blue field colour full of tribal symbology and motifs. The colours are varied and soft. A most beautiful weaving getting harder to source earlier examples especially of this size.

As you would expect from a carpet of good age there has been two repairs one to each end. Done very competently and tidy. Both imaged.

Low even pile with a small amount of wear to one end.

All sides and ends secured. Hand washed and de-dusted.

Carpet priced accordingly. Plenty of images.

10 foot by 6 foot. 305cm X 183cm. At widest points. All woollen construction .

Khamseh carpets originate from a tribal confederation in Fars province in southwestern Iran. They are characterised by intricate geometric patterns, central diamond medallions, and motifs depicting stylised flora and fauna woven from memory rather than drawn cartoons.

These carpets are hand-knotted using locally sourced hand-spun sheep wool for both the pile and the foundation warp and weft. The yarns are coloured using plant and mineral dyes, producing saturated hues of navy blue, terracotta red, ochre, and ivory.

Authentic pieces display slight irregularities in weave density, asymmetry in design motifs, and natural abrash colour variations within the wool. Examination of the reverse side reveals clear hand-tied knots and flexible, hand-bound selvedges.

A geometric tribal carpet anchors minimalist, traditional, or eclectic room schemes by introducing pattern and visual weight. Placing the rug beneath neutral-toned contemporary furniture allows the rich colour palette and geometric borders to serve as the focal point.

Regular maintenance requires gentle vacuuming without a rotating brush bar to protect the wool fibers. Professional dry rug cleaning and prompt spot cleaning with cold water and pH-neutral soap ensure the long-term preservation of natural dyes.
